Trosolwg o'r swydd

An opportunity has arisen for a motivated and dedicated individual to join our team. Committed to providing an efficient and effective front-line service in our Reception based at Berrywood Hospital, Northampton.

The successful applicant must be reliable, able to work flexibly and be committed to providing a quality service. A professional telephone manner and good organisational and communication skills are essential; previous switchboard experience would be an advantage although full training will be provided.

Shift Pattern:

Week one: Saturday 08:30 - 19:30 (30 Minute unpaid break)=10.5hr shift. Week two: Saturday 08:30-13:30 = 5hr shift. 

(These hours are subject to change):

Weekend shifts are paid at the current NHS additional enhanced rate of pay. Flexibility to cover as and when required for staff absence is required.

Prif ddyletswyddau'r swydd

Some of the main duties of this job include:

  • Provide a quality, professional ‘front of house’ reception service.
  • Be customer focused, polite, and have a professional appearance.
  • Flexibility is required to work additional hours including bank holidays.
  • Answer incoming calls quickly and politely.
  • Support clinicians on booking in appointments on system one as applicable.
  • Welcome visitors and staff at reception and assist with any queries.
  • Ensure on-call books and duty rotas are kept up to date and amended as changes occur.
  • Respond immediately to all emergency/intruder alarms and emergencies and carry out the prescribed procedure quickly.
  • Ensure any incidents are recorded accurately.
  • Maintain the diary, booking meeting rooms and taxis using the relevant procedure where appropriate.
  • Operate the Trust Facilities Help Desk and PFI (Kiers/Robertsons) helpdesk when required.
  • Issue keys as requested ensuring that they are signed for and returned.
  • Sort internal and external mail as required.
  • Undertake administration duties as required.
  • Take an active role in keeping the reception area tidy, including vacuuming, polishing and general high and low dusting.

Gweithio i'n sefydliad

NHFT is an integrated primary care and mental health Trust, providing physical, mental health and specialty services in both hospital settings and out in the community. Because we put the person at the centre of all we do, we focus on delivering care that is as easy to access as possible. This means many of our services can be provided at home, work or in schools. We also provide health services to various prisons and detention centres in Bedfordshire and Cambridgeshire.
